HOW DO SCRATCH NIGHTS WORK?
- We have three slots available at each scratch night;
- Each slot lasts up to 15-20 minutes;
- Your work can be at any stage of its development;
- Your work can be a play, a song, a poem or a spoken word piece;
- A fee of £150 will be paid for each slot;
- Rehearsal space will be provided on the day;
WHAT DO SCRATCH NIGHTS AT STRATFORD EAST LOOK LIKE?
Our Scratch Nights are held in Stratford East's Bar. There is no stage but a small performance space with a PA system. It is a relaxed, welcoming and encouraging space so even if you don't apply - come down and check it out!
